Welcome to Dimitra Traditional Cafe & Restaurant, a hidden gem nestled in the heart of Kardiani, Greece. This charming cafe provides an enchanting blend of traditional Tinian cuisine and warm hospitality, making it a must-visit destination for food lovers and travelers alike.
The ambiance of Dimitra's is as inviting as its menu. With blue chairs adorning a cozy setup, the cafe offers a peaceful respite where patrons can savor the authentic flavors of Greece. Guests often rave about the delightful housemade pies, including the beloved spinach and zucchini varieties. As Ruby Swinney noted, these dishes are not just tasty; they are an essential part of your culinary journey in Tinos. The galaktoboureko and orange cake, paired perfectly with a rich Greek coffee, are just a couple of the sweet indulgences that await you.
Every visit promises friendly service, echoing the sentiments of Constance Delvinquiere, who described the hosts as “the sweetest.” This warmth adds to the overall dining experience and makes you feel at home, whether you’re popping in for a quick refreshment or enjoying a leisurely meal.
Despite its small size, the menu never disappoints. Guests recommend savoring the artichoke pie and local cheese, often highlighting their deliciousness. As Per Jessen remarked after just sampling a few items, he was compelled to give a rare five-star rating, reflecting the high standards set by the cafe's offerings.
However, be prepared for the cafe’s limited seating; it can fill up quickly, as mentioned by Σταύρος Κουμζής. The intimate setting might mean that travelers will need to arrive early or right when the doors open in order to secure a spot among the few tables available.

“ A very cute café in the heart of Kardiani. It is very charming with its blue chairs and location. They serve traditional food, we arrived late and they were closing in twenty minutes so they had limited choices. Everything was delicious and they were kind enough to still serve us. ”
“ Our favourite place during our stay in Kardiani! Warm and friendly service, delicious housemade pies (we shared two every morning - spinach and zucchini were so good!), and the galaktoboureko and orange cake were superb with Greek coffee. Will be back for dinner some day! A must if you’re in Tinos. ”

“ Hidden in the streets of Kardiani, beautiful, traditional blue chairs. Our goat was tasty and fava ecxellent. The wine from Zitsa cooled well and fresh for summer. Hidden from meltemi. The service was super friendly and funny and evev thougb we just wanted to drink we ended up having dinner. ”
